    Calling the TARDIS “the ship” is largely a Hartnell era thing, I can’t think of many times that happens afterwards. It’s something unique about these early years of the show that I enjoy.

    • @andrewgwilliam4831
      @andrewgwilliam4831 26 วันที่ผ่านมา +2

      I looked into it a few years ago, using the transcripts, and found that it was still in use (but fading out) during the Troughton era. There were a tiny number of indirect references in the 1970s before its use was revived during the Davison era (for reasons that I won't elaborate on so as not to spoil anything for our host).
      Interestingly it was brought back for New Who right from the beginning, but has only been used occasionally except perhaps for a more frequent usage during the Chibnall era.
